Sony Group(SONY) - 2026 Q3 - Earnings Call Transcript
2026-02-05 08:00
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- Sales of continuing operations in FY 2025 Q3 increased by 1% year-on-year to JPY 3,713.7 billion, while operating income rose by 22% to JPY 515 billion, both record highs for the third quarter [2] - Net income increased by 11% to JPY 377.3 billion [2] - Full-year sales forecast was upwardly revised by 3% to JPY 12,300 billion, operating income forecast increased by 8% to JPY 1,540 billion, and net income forecast also increased by 8% to JPY 1,130 billion [2] Business Segment Data and Key Metrics Changes - G&NS segment sales decreased by 4% year-on-year, but operating income increased by 19% due to favorable foreign exchange rates and increased sales in network services and first-party software [3] - Music segment sales increased by 13% year-on-year, with operating income rising by 9%, driven by live events and streaming revenue [6][7] - ET&S segment sales decreased by 7% year-on-year, and operating income decreased by 23% due to lower sales [12] - I&SS segment sales increased by 21% year-on-year, and operating income increased by 35%, both record highs for the segment [14][15]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- Monthly active users across all PlayStation platforms increased by 2% year-on-year to a record high of 132 million accounts [4] - Total playtime for the quarter increased by 0.4% year-on-year [4] - The global interchangeable lens camera market demand remained strong year-on-year, particularly in Asia [13]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company plans to enhance its music, video, and event business by leveraging Peanuts IP, aiming for long-term growth [11][12] - A strategic partnership with TCL aims to strengthen the home entertainment business through a joint venture [14][26] - The company intends to prioritize monetization of its existing install base and expand software and network service revenue in the gaming segment [5]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management acknowledged the uncertain business environment but expressed confidence in achieving results as the fiscal year-end approaches [17] - Concerns regarding memory supply and pricing were noted, with management indicating a focus on improving profitability and optimizing the business portfolio [23][45] - The company remains optimistic about the upcoming software lineup in the gaming and Sony Pictures segments [45] Other Important Information - The company increased its share repurchase facility from JPY 100 billion to JPY 150 billion, reflecting confidence in its business fundamentals [17][52] - The acquisition of an additional equity interest in Peanuts Holdings is expected to contribute approximately JPY 45 billion to operating income [7] Q&A Session Summary Question: About the game "Marathon" and its strategic significance - Management explained that user feedback led to modifications before the release, emphasizing the importance of live service games for recurring revenue [20] Question: Concerns about stock price performance - Management acknowledged market concerns regarding memory supply and the overall entertainment sector but emphasized a focus on improving business fundamentals [23] Question: About the strategic partnership with TCL - Management clarified that the partnership aims to optimize the home entertainment business, including TV and home audio [26] Question: Impact of rising memory prices on PS5 - Management indicated that while there may be some impact on hardware sales, the focus will remain on software and network services, which are expected to continue contributing significantly [28] Question: Music streaming revenue growth prospects - Management expressed confidence in mid to long-term growth in the music business, driven by increasing average revenue per user and user numbers [31] Question: Generative AI's impact on game development - Management views generative AI as a tool that can enhance creativity in game development, emphasizing the need for integration with human sensitivity [61]

A. O. Smith(AOS) - 2025 Q4 - Earnings Call Transcript
2026-01-29 16:02
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- The company reported sales of $3.8 billion in 2025, a slight increase over the previous year, with earnings per share (EPS) rising 6% to a record $3.85 [10][6] - Free cash flow for 2025 was $546 million, a 15% increase compared to 2024, with a free cash flow conversion rate of 100% [13][14] - The company returned $597 million to shareholders through dividends and share repurchases [6][14]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- North America segment sales were $3 billion, slightly up from 2024, with a segment margin of 24.4%, an increase of 20 basis points year-over-year [10][11] - North America water heater sales increased by 1%, while boiler sales grew by 8% due to higher commercial and residential volumes [7][10] - Water treatment sales in North America decreased by 2%, but sales in priority channels grew by 10% [8][9] - Rest of the World segment sales decreased by 4% to $880 million, primarily due to lower sales in China [11][12]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- In China, third-party sales decreased by 12% in local currency due to economic weakness and soft consumer demand [9][11] - The company expects China sales to decrease mid-single digits in 2026 due to ongoing market challenges [20][21] - The India business, including Pureit, is projected to grow approximately 10% as the company leverages brand synergies [21][28]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company is focused on portfolio management, innovation, and operational excellence as key strategic priorities [22][24] - The acquisition of Leonard Valve is aimed at expanding into the water management market, enhancing digital capabilities and integrated product offerings [26][27] - The company plans to continue investing in gas tankless offerings and other energy-efficient products to maintain market leadership [16][22]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management noted that the U.S. residential market is expected to remain flat to down due to pressures in new home construction [18][19] - The company anticipates a return to growth in China in the second half of 2026, driven by internal actions and market recovery [21][38] - Management expressed confidence in the company's ability to navigate competitive pressures and maintain profitability through strategic actions [28][29] Other Important Information - The company has increased its dividend for over 30 consecutive years, with a quarterly dividend of $0.36 per share approved [14][15] - The company expects to repurchase approximately $200 million of its stock in 2026 [17][15] Q&A Session Summary Question: What is driving the persistent downturn in residential volumes? - Management indicated that the downturn is primarily due to pressures in new home construction, with emergency and proactive replacements remaining stable [36][37] Question: What indicators suggest a return to growth in China? - Management highlighted the need to move past the impact of government subsidies and focus on remodeling and refurbishments as key drivers for growth [38] Question: Can you elaborate on the competitive intensity in the wholesale channel? - Management noted that competitive pressure is increasing due to low new home construction and retail gaining market share, but emphasized their strong position in both retail and wholesale channels [42][43] Question: What is the growth outlook for the water treatment business? - Management expressed optimism about continued growth and margin expansion in the water treatment business, driven by strategic focus and integration efforts [70][73]
